Transaction 898a102d68b4c16036d017a7deb85d9b560379bf9783ac98ee02e0b0532eab87
1 Input
1 Output
-
898a102d68b4c16036d017a7deb85d9b560379bf9783ac98ee02e0b0532eab87:0
- value
- 1886990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09b26ba26ecb34c7e1b02fd81e9f5db6025542c1 OP_EQUAL
- address
- 32aHk961R88KLp9pw4aZ3TSvBVwiDExxFR